How do I remove the EMI shields on the logic board without a heat gun?

I have an iPhone 6 that suffered water damage, and whenever I tr to restore it, I get iTunes error (-1). After doing some research, I found that it's an hardware issue with the baseband chip(please correct me if I'm wrong).

Anyways, how would I go about removing the shields on the logic board without a heat gun? I already have a soldering kit handy, and I'm not willing to go out and get a heat gun. Please let me know, thanks!

@sywy1873 You can use your soldering iron to remove those shields. If you are thinking about maybe doing more repairs, I would reconsider and suggest the purchase of a good rework station that would include the hot air tool.

Anyhow, the EMI shields are thin Tin and can be cut with a good pair of small scissors. Looks amateurish when they get cut like that but they will do come off.

I remove then with a screwdriver and slowly prying them off; I never use heat because it always heats the things under the sheild too.
